Apply the framework table below; explain selected method(s), assumptions, and output. ## Valuation method selection guide | Scenario | Preferred method | Why | | --------------------------------------- | ---------------- | --------------------------------------- | | Stable earnings, mature company | PE-Band / PB | Simple; market-anchored | | Asset-heavy (banks, insurance) | PB-ROE | Book value reflects true asset base | | Capital-intensive (telecom, utilities) | EV/EBITDA | Strips out D&A and leverage differences | | High-growth, pre-profit (biotech, SaaS) | PS / DCF | No earnings yet; revenue is the anchor | | Conglomerate / multi-segment | SOTP | Each segment deserves its own multiple | | Dividend-paying mature company | DDM | Intrinsic value from future dividends | | Asset-rich company (property) | NAV | Book value adjusted to market prices | ## Method details ### Relative valuation **PE-Band**: Plot trailing/forward PE against 1–3 year historical mean ± 1SD. Buy signal when PE < mean - 1SD, stretched when > mean + 1SD. Use `longbridge valuation <SYMBOL> --format json` for historical percentile. **PB-ROE**: High ROE justifies high PB. Plot PB vs ROE scatter across peers. Companies above the regression line are expensive; below are cheap. Fetch ROE from `longbridge financial-report <SYMBOL> --kind IS --format json`. **EV/EBITDA**: Enterprise-value based; immune to capital structure. Use for cross-border comparisons. EV = market cap + net debt; EBITDA from IS + D&A line. **PS**: Revenue multiple. Useful when earnings are negative. Compress to gross-profit multiple (EV/GP) for SaaS with different gross margins. ### Absolute valuation **DCF**: Project free cash flows → discount at WACC → add terminal value. Full workflow in `longbridge-dcf`. **DDM**: `P = D₁ / (r - g)`. Best for high-dividend stocks (utilities, HK REITs). Inputs: next dividend (D₁), cost of equity (r), long-run dividend growth (g). **SOTP**: Segment A value + Segment B value + Net cash − Holding discount. Requires segment-level revenue/EBIT from financial reports. ## Common pitfalls - Using PE for loss-making companies — use PS or EV/Sales instead. - Anchoring WACC to an arbitrary 10% — verify Beta and risk-free rate. - Ignoring net debt in EV/EBITDA — EV must include all debt and minority interests. - Applying a single PE without cyclicality adjustment — use normalized or mid-cycle earnings. - SOTP double-counting — ensure holding-company cash is not counted twice. ## CLI ```bash # Verify available flags first longbridge valuation --help longbridge industry-valuation --help longbridge financial-report --help # Fetch current multiples longbridge valuation <SYMBOL> --format json # Industry context longbridge industry-valuation <SYMBOL> --format json # Income statement for margin/growth longbridge financial-report <SYMBOL> --kind IS --format json ``` ## Output Present: 1.
